Skip to content

Commit 7218393

Browse files
author
Remigiusz Kołłątaj
committed
Add DEV_BUILD=OFF to macOS
Signed-off-by: Remigiusz Kołłątaj <[email protected]>
1 parent 44707b3 commit 7218393

File tree

1 file changed

+22
-0
lines changed

1 file changed

+22
-0
lines changed

travis/build.sh

+22
Original file line numberDiff line numberDiff line change
@@ -20,9 +20,31 @@ else
2020
cmake --build build-osx --config Release --target install
2121
cd build-osx
2222
ctest
23+
24+
# DEV_BUILD=ON (master)
2325
cpack -G DragNDrop
26+
mkdir master
27+
mv *.dmg master
28+
29+
# Deploy (master)
30+
cd master
2431
for f in *.dmg; do
2532
curl -T $f -urkollataj:$BINTRAY_API_KEY https://api.bintray.com/content/rkollataj/CANdevStudio/master/${TRAVIS_COMMIT:0:7}/$f\;override=1
2633
done
2734
curl -urkollataj:$BINTRAY_API_KEY -X POST https://api.bintray.com/content/rkollataj/CANdevStudio/master/${TRAVIS_COMMIT:0:7}/publish
35+
cd ..
36+
37+
# DEV_BUILD=OFF (rc)
38+
cmake . -DDEV_BUILD=OFF
39+
cpack -G DragNDrop
40+
mkdir rc
41+
mv *.dmg rc
42+
43+
# Deploy (rc)
44+
cd rc
45+
for f in *.dmg; do
46+
curl -T $f -urkollataj:$BINTRAY_API_KEY https://api.bintray.com/content/rkollataj/CANdevStudio/cds/rc/$f\;override=1
47+
done
48+
curl -urkollataj:$BINTRAY_API_KEY -X POST https://api.bintray.com/content/rkollataj/CANdevStudio/cds/rc/publish
49+
cd ..
2850
fi

0 commit comments

Comments
 (0)